Sefer Likutei Moharan – Lemberg, 1809 - Sefer Likutei Moharan, Parts I–II, Kedama and Tinyana, by the Holy Rabbi Nachman of Breslov. “1809” [Lemberg/Zolkiew/1830s?]. [1], 80; 29 leaves (lacking the last two leaves of the first part). 21 cm. Good–fair condition. Slight stains and wear. New leather binding. Stefansky Chassidut, no. 285. The title page does not state the place of printing. The printed year is 1809 [which is not possible, as Rabbi Nachman of Breslov passed away in 1811, and the title page refers to him as “of blessed and holy memory”]. Scholars are divided as to when and where this edition was printed—whether in Lemberg, Zolkiew, or Korets. Rabbi Natan Zvi Koenig (Nevei Tzaddikim, Bnei Brak 1969, p. 41) writes: Lemberg, circa 1830. In contrast, Rosenthal (Yodea Sefer) and the CZA catalog list: Korets 1809.
